Research and Special Interests:
Research performed under Dr. Daniel J Canney. Designed, synthesized, and characterized novel organosilicone based and chromone based Retinoic Acid Receptor (RAR) ligands.
In an ongoing research, some of these novel compounds are being tested in a Nuclear Hormone Receptors (NHRs) screening panel in a dose/response mode by a pharmaceutical company for further characterization. Elucidation of molecular and metabolic pathways fundamental to RARs functions. Development of barbiturates for structure relationship studies of Nicotinic Ach receptor ligands and non-thesis, interdisciplinary NSAIDS projects.
